Where to see the Slingsby glider family in the UK

The gazetteer records the Slingsby glider family at 7 UK collections, in 6 regions: London & Around, East of England, South East England, Midlands & Lincolnshire, Northern England, Northern Ireland.

MuseumCityRegionAirframes recorded
Midland Air Museum Coventry Midlands & Lincolnshire
Newark Air Museum Newark Midlands & Lincolnshire
Royal Air Force Museum London London London & Around
Solent Sky Southampton South East England
The Shuttleworth Collection Biggleswade East of England
Ulster Aviation Society (Maze Long Kesh) Lisburn Northern Ireland
Yorkshire Air Museum York Northern England
